Phthalocyanine reverse saturable absorption compounds were systematically studied to search after the new type laser protective materials and their preparation technology. Theory of nonlinear optics and optical limiting technology and types of this kind material were discussed detailed. Among the large number of nonlinear absorbers, the material applied most extensively is phthalocyanine reverse saturable absorption compound which is organic large molecule with central symmetry two-dimensional π -electron conjugate system. In the off-resonance condition, its absorption coefficient will raise along with the increasing of incoming light intensity, which shows its reverse saturable absorption(RSA) properties.In this dissertation, four kinds of metal phthalocyanine were synthesized. The phthalocyanine/PMMA material optical devices were prepared by founding forming method, sliding method and injection method et al. Their reverse saturable absorption properties were studied. We have made benefic trails on the research of optical limiting materials with broad protective wavelength, high optical density and high transmission.
